Output e23221c23a79ba132fc45f478041867860d6b88b7bad4ee7141c5d9724a075b6:1

value
215843
script pubkey
OP_0 OP_PUSHBYTES_20 151ba5201837a59a470d674a2aa76649ea40cfe7
address
ltc1qz5d62gqcx7je53cdva9z4fmxf84ypnl8tdgje7
transaction
e23221c23a79ba132fc45f478041867860d6b88b7bad4ee7141c5d9724a075b6
spent
true